Topic Overview
China's Global Governance Initiative is a reform effort aimed at reshaping international structures for a more just and equitable global order. Recent developments highlight Hong Kong's strategic importance within this initiative. Analysts suggest the city can serve as a hub for international organizations and a leader in standard-setting, contributing to Beijing's vision for global governance reform. The "More Just and Equitable Global Governance" white paper, published by China's State Council, elaborates on this initiative. Furthermore, the Global Prosperity Summit 2026 in Hong Kong underscored the city's expanding role in regional cooperation, particularly within the framework of China's Global Governance Initiative and APEC, ahead of a major APEC economic leaders' meeting. These events underscore the initiative's current relevance and Hong Kong's pivotal position in its advancement.
